Certovica is the highest paved mountain pass of Slovakia

Čertovica is a mountain pass at an elevation of 1.242m (4,074ft) above the sea level, located on the boundary of Žilina and Banská Bystrica regions of Slovakia. At this elevation it’s said to be the highest paved mountain pass in Slovakia.

Is the road to Certovica paved?

Set high in the heart of the Low Tatras, the road to the summit is totally paved. It’s called Route 72. The summit hosts a ski resort, a hotel and restaurants. Access to the pass is typically open all year round but short term closures are common in winter due to dangerous weather conditions.

How long is Certovica pass?

The pass is 20.7 km (12.86 miles) long running from Nižná Boca to Jarabá. The road to the summit is very steep, hitting a 9% of maximum gradient through some of the ramps.
